About Hawkhurst
Hawkhurst is a small rural locality in the Wellington Shire of Gippsland, Victoria, situated in the foothills of the Great Dividing Range near the Mitchell River valley. Located east of Heyfield and west of Bairnsdale, the area is characterised by undulating cattle country, plantation timber and native bushland at the northern edge of the Gippsland Plains. The locality is very sparsely populated, functioning primarily as agricultural land rather than a defined residential community. Its rural landscape and clean mountain air are typical of the upper Gippsland foothills.
The nearest service centre for Hawkhurst residents is the town of Heyfield, which offers a primary school, supermarket and medical clinic. Sale, the regional city of Wellington Shire approximately 50 kilometres to the south, provides the full range of retail, educational and health services. The area appeals to those engaged in cattle grazing, plantation forestry and hobby farming, with the Licola and alpine areas accessible to the north for four-wheel driving and bushwalking. The Avon and Mitchell rivers nearby offer good trout fishing for outdoor enthusiasts.
